Top 5 MOBA Apps Performance on Android in the UK for Q3 2024

In the third quarter of 2024, the MOBA genre on the Android platform in the United Kingdom saw varied performance across its top applications. Here's a closer look at the trends for the top five MOBA apps based on data from Sensor Tower.

Brawl Stars from Supercell experienced fluctuations in its weekly revenue, which peaked at approximately $68.7K in mid-September. Weekly downloads for this app showed a notable increase in early September, reaching around 14.9K, while the weekly active users saw a decline from 350.3K at the start of the quarter to about 289K by the end of September.

Squad Busters, another title from Supercell, had its weekly revenue peaking at $32.3K at the start of July, followed by a general decline, ending the quarter with about $21.3K. Downloads started strong at 15.4K but saw a significant drop, closing the quarter at around 1.1K. Active user numbers also saw a downward trend from 24.2K to approximately 9K.

Mobile Legends: Bang Bang by Moonton maintained relatively stable weekly revenue, with figures hovering around $22K throughout the quarter. Downloads peaked twice, first in late July at 5K and then again in late September at around 5.2K. Active users fluctuated, starting at 15.4K, peaking at 20.4K in late September, and slightly decreasing to 19.9K at the end of the quarter.

League of Legends: Wild Rift from Riot Games, Inc. showed a varied revenue trend, with weekly figures reaching up to $12.5K in mid-September. Download numbers remained relatively low, averaging around 500 throughout the quarter. Active users hovered in the 5K to 6K range, showing slight fluctuations.

Honor of Kings by Level Infinite had modest weekly revenue, peaking at $3.8K in late August. Downloads decreased steadily throughout the quarter, from 4K in early July to approximately 660 by the end of September. Active users showed a small increase, closing the quarter at around 6.3K.
